SUZUKI ANDREA LANNONE MOTOGP SUIT 2018
The Andrea Iannone Suzuki MotoGP suit is crafted with precision using top-grain leather, carefully selected and drum-dyed to ensure outstanding abrasion resistance, strength, and long-lasting performance. Designed for riders who demand both safety and comfort, this race suit integrates advanced protection technologies with premium materials for maximum confidence on the track.
To enhance impact resistance, CE-approved internal protectors are strategically placed on the shoulders, elbows, and knees. Key high-impact zones—including the shoulders, elbows, knees, and hips—are reinforced with an additional layer of leather, offering increased durability against crashes and drag. Foam padding at the elbows and knees provides an extra shield to minimize the force of impact, while the pre-curved sleeve design ensures an ergonomic fit, allowing riders to maintain the correct racing position with ease.
Safety is further reinforced through strong seam construction, with dual stitching and triple stitching applied at critical points for greater tear resistance. Semi auto-lock YKK zippers deliver a secure closure system, ensuring the suit remains properly fastened during high-speed performance. The suit also features removable dual-density armor at the knees, shoulders, and elbows, along with a detachable spine protector for versatile protection tailored to rider preference.
Additional racing features include removable knee sliders for adaptability and rubber padding on critical areas, available as an optional upgrade for riders seeking added safety. For enhanced aerodynamics and spinal protection, the suit can be equipped with an extended speed hump—an optional feature designed to improve neck and backbone security during extreme racing conditions.
